The Henry Bulletin, May 7, 1926
THE HENRY BULLETIN, May 7, 1926, p. 7, cols. 1 & 2 [edited].  Dodson, Patrick 
County, Va., May 5. - - The people of this community were greatly shocked on 
Monday, May the 3rd, to hear of the almost sudden death of Miss Martha Wright, 
age 13, youngest daughter of Mr. and Mrs. Ezra Wright, death being caused y a 
hemorrhage of the brain.  She was tenderly laid to rest on Tuesday evening near 
her home.  The following acted as pall bearers: Active - J. Lester Roberson, J. 
A. Turner, Thomas Bryant, H. H. Emberson, O. T. McCray,  J. W. Bouldin,  H. G. 
McAlenxander and Peter Martin.  She leaves to mourn her loss a devoted father 
and mother, one sister, Mrs. Ruth Via and one brother, Mr. Charlie Wright of 
Ferrum.  Martha was such a bright and good child, having completed the 7th grade 
and won her diploma only 2 weeks ago. Those from a distance to attend the 
funeral were Mr. and Mrs. Murray Thompson of Stuart, Mr. P. G. Wright and 
daughter Mildred of Sanville, Mr. and Mrs. Walter Via and Mrs. Bettie Via of 
Fieldale, Mr. and Mrs. Willie France and children and Mrs. Posey France, Mr. and 
Mrs. Harden Ingram and baby from Franklin County, and Mr. O.T. McCray and J. W. 
Bouldin of Martinsville.
